Summary
A Second World War military ordnance dump is visible as buildings on historic aerial photographs. Located on the A509 between Horn Wood and Stocking Hollow are 10 rectangular military buildings/covered ammunition stands grouped in 5 pairs. These were storage areas for the Sharnbrook Forward Ammunition Supply Depot (AAF-583) (NRHE 1619112), used for bomb and ammunition storage to supply operational airbases occupied by the 1st Air Division of the US 8th Air Force. Military stores were delivered to Sharnbrook railway station and then dispersed into storage areas alongside public roads. Aerial photographs taken in 1968 suggest that all of the ordnance dump buildings/structures have been demolished by that time.

Full Description
{1-2} A Second World War military ordnance dump is visible as buildings on historic aerial photographs and was mapped as part of the Bedford Borough NMP project. Located on the A509 between Horn Wood and Stocking Hollow and centred at SP 90202 57806, 10 rectangular military buildings/covered ammunition stands, each about 4.5 x 2.5 metres and set out in a group of 5 pairs. These ammunition dumps were storage areas for the Sharnbrook Forward Ammunition Supply Depot (AAF-583) (NRHE 1619112), an Ordnance Depot used for bomb and ammunition storage to supply operational airbases occupied by the 1st Air Division of the US 8th Air Force. Military stores were delivered by rail to Sharnbrook station, whereupon they were deposited into these storage areas dispersed alongside public roads. Aerial photographs taken in 1968 suggest that all of the ordnance dump buildings/structures have been demolished by that time.
